| I've just secured an apartment in Lantau DB and it is not too expensive. There are plenty of affordable places in DB (I'm not an investment banker and on a reasonable salary). I would recommend DB as there are plenty of facilities for children and plenty of playgrounds outside most of the apartment blocks. There are no cars so the roads are a bit safer and there are a few schools and playgroups around, ballet football, rugby, gymboree...... Commute to Central really good. |

| If you are looking for three beds try Mui Wo as the places there are cheaper than DB but there aren't as many facilities. You'll be looking at about HK$8,000 for 3 beds and a roof terrace. I'm paying HK$10,000 for a one bed in DB but I am GF with a garden / terrace and balcony. |

| Just to give you an idea, my neighbours have a 3 storey house, 4 bedrooms (including a huge master bedroom occupying a whole floor with sea views), large open plan kitchen / dining area and lounge with front and back gardens and they pay $14,000 a month, just gone up from $12k. |
